What is Project Management in Logistics Staffing?

Back to Glossary

Project management in logistics staffing refers to the strategic planning, execution, and monitoring of workforce resources to ensure that logistics operations run efficiently and effectively. In the world of logistics, having the right personnel in place at the right time can determine the success of operations. This article explores what project management in logistics staffing entails and how dedicated solutions can optimize business outcomes.

Understanding Project Management in Logistics Staffing

Project management in logistics staffing is a systematic approach to managing manpower resources to fulfill logistics needs. This includes overseeing recruitment, workforce allocation, training, performance monitoring, and risk management. The primary goal is to maintain operational efficiency while meeting client demands.

Key Components of Project Management in Logistics Staffing

  1. Recruitment

    • A targeted process for sourcing and hiring qualified candidates.
    • Focus on aligning skills and experiences with specific operational needs.
  2. Training and Development

    • Comprehensive onboarding programs to equip employees with necessary skills.
    • Continuous training initiatives to enhance productivity and safety.
  3. Performance Management

    • Regular assessments of employee performance to identify areas for improvement.
    • Use of key performance indicators (KPIs) to measure operational success.
  4. Risk Assessment and Management

    • Identifying potential risks in staffing logistics and mitigating them proactively.
    • Developing contingency plans, ensuring business continuity.

Benefits of Effective Project Management in Logistics Staffing

Implementing robust project management practices in logistics staffing results in various advantages:

  • Operational Efficiency
    Effective management leads to streamlined operations, reducing downtime and ensuring timely deliveries.

  • Cost-Effectiveness
    Properly managing staffing resources optimizes labor costs, avoiding overstaffing or understaffing.

  • Enhanced Productivity
    A motivated workforce trained to meet specific goals contributes to improved output.

  • Scalability
    Flexible staffing solutions allow businesses to scale operations according to demand fluctuations, ensuring they can respond to seasonal changes.

How to Implement Project Management in Logistics Staffing

To effectively execute project management in logistics staffing, follow these steps:

  1. Define Project Goals
    Clearly outline objectives for the logistics project, including timelines and budgets.

  2. Develop a Comprehensive Staffing Plan
    Identify specific staffing needs and outline recruitment strategies.

  3. Select Qualified Personnel
    Use rigorous screening processes to recruit employees who fit the operational needs.

  4. Provide Ongoing Training
    Focus on continuous improvement through training sessions and upskilling initiatives.

  5. Monitor Progress and Adjust
    Regularly evaluate performance against KPIs and make adjustments to strategies as needed.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the challenges in project management of logistics staffing?

Challenges may include fluctuating demand, high turnover rates, and difficulty in finding qualified personnel. Proactive risk management and ongoing training can help address these challenges.

How does project management improve workforce performance in logistics?

Through structured training, continuous performance assessment, and clear communication of expectations, project management enhances workforce performance by ensuring employees are equipped to meet operational goals.
